eZ Systems is the laureate of the Fransk-Norsk Trophée 2016

The French-Norwegian Day is an annual event organized by the French-Norwegian Chamber of Commerce in Oslo. This day gathers the French-Norwegian business community for a conference, workshops and gala dinner. The theme this year was “Digital Transformation”. The day was divided in three parts:

 

 

 

  • A conference at BI Norwegian Business School in the morning 
  • Two parallel workshops in the afternoon, focusing on Smart City and Industry 4.0. (see programme here)
  • An exclusive Gala Dinner at Gamle Logen and the award of the prestigious Fransk-Norsk Trophée 2016.


120 participants from 70 Norwegian and French companies attended the conference, and 130 guests joined the gala dinner. This event was made possible by our sponsors and partners, including BI Norwegian Business School, Bureau Veritas, Capgemini Consulting, Engie, Sopra Steria, Schneider Electric, Peugeot/Citroën/DS automobiles, Total, the French-Norwegian Foundation, City of Oslo, INSA Toulouse, Oliviers&Co, Vinhuset, Åpent Bakeri, SebastienBruno and Air France-KLM.

 

The conference was opened by Inge Jan Henjesand, President of BI Norwegian Business School, Sindre Walderhaug, President of the French-Norwegian Chamber of Commerce, and H.E. Jean-François Dobelle, Ambassador of France to Norway.


Highly recognized speakers animated the conference with Espen Andersen, Director of the center for Digitization at BI Norwegian Business School, as moderator. H.E. Rolf Einar Fife, Ambassador of Norway to France gave the closing remarks.

 

 

In the afternoon, two parallel workshops gathered a group of 20-25 participants each, for a reflection on Smart Cities and Industry 4.0. Key players from France and Norway shared their views about these topics, and the presentations were followed by a debate. This day connects French and Norwegian participants from industries that do not necessarily meet each other and facilitates the discussion towards concrete and innovative projects.

The Fransk-Norsk Trophée 2016 was awarded to eZ Systems. The French-Norwegian Chamber of Commerce and its partner Air France-KLM handed over the symbolic bronze statue to Aleksander Farstad, CEO of the company, and his team, Bertrand Maugain, Eiren Birkeland and Abdul Zamir.

 

Founded in 1999 by two brothers, Aleksander and Bård Farstad, eZ Systems (lien) has consistently continued to grow to become an international leader in the field of content management systems, helping companies deliver digital experiences. The Fransk-Norsk Trophée rewards every year a company, an organization, or a person, who has significantly contributed to the French-Norwegian exchanges by its dynamism. The jury highlighted the work done by eZ on entrepreneurship and the development of partnerships with French actors.

 

- “We are extremely proud to receive this prestigious award which represents a significant acknowledgement of the success of eZ. We managed to establish ourselves on the French market and to build relationships with several key business leaders including BPCE (Caisse d’Epargne) and Crédit Agricole, Mondadori, Prismapress, Lagardère, Orange, Michelin and the French authorities.”

 

- “We are passionate about the added value of the content and to work every day to offer digital solutions creating positive user experience for our customers. Originally, we are a Norwegian company, but we are also global, with strategic entities in France and Norway. Considering the companies that won the trophée in previous years, we are in good company, says Aleksander Farstad, Director of eZ Systems.”
